Smart revisits Always On plans with cheaper rates

Smart has revised their Alway On plans to offer more bucket options and drive prices down. The new plan starts at Php10USD 0.17INR 14EUR 0.16CNY 1 for 5MB of mobile internet usable in 24 hours.

Here are the bucket pricing from last year and when you compare that to the new table below, you will notice some of the plans were reduced while others remained the same (an indication that the move is to level with competition, otherwise it would have been across the board).

The 1GB bucket is now Php499USD 9INR 721EUR 8CNY 62 from Php750USD 13INR 1,083EUR 12CNY 93 last year (same with Globe PowerSurf 499) while the 250MB bucket is now Php199USD 3INR 287EUR 3CNY 25 from Php300USD 5INR 433EUR 5CNY 37. The 50MB for Php99USD 2INR 143EUR 2CNY 12 for 30days was also introduced (now exactly the same as Globe PowerSurf 99).

The revised Always On plans now make Smart’s offering better compared to Globe’s PowerSurf. However, the main difference between the two is that Smart’s Always On plans are available to SmartBro prepaid users and not postpaid subscribers. It’s also available to Smart Postpaid GSM subs as well.
